Delayed haemorrhage and pseudoaneurysms following liver trauma

Delayed hemorrhage (DH) and hepatic artery pseudoaneurysms (HAPAs) following liver trauma are rare complications. This study found no direct association between DH and HAPA, suggesting HAPAs cause slow bleeding rather than catastrophic rupture.
Area of Science:
- Trauma Surgery
- Vascular Surgery
- Hepatobiliary Surgery
Background:
- Delayed Hemorrhage (DH) and Hepatic Artery Pseudoaneurysms (HAPAs) are known, though rare, complications after liver trauma.
- The natural history of HAPAs and their potential link to DH remain poorly understood.
- Some research suggests DH may originate from HAPAs.
Purpose of the Study:
- To determine the incidence of DH and HAPA after liver trauma.
- To review the management of these conditions.
- To explore a potential association between DH and HAPA.
Main Methods:
- Retrospective analysis of liver trauma cases over 14 years.
- Case-control study comparing patients with DH and HAPA to matched controls.
- Analysis included injury grade, transfusion requirements, and imaging findings.
Main Results:
- DH occurred in 2.2% and HAPA in 1.6% of 450 liver trauma patients.
- Both DH and HAPA groups required more transfusions and had lower/decreasing hemoglobin levels.
- No HAPA patients had significant hemoperitoneum, and no DH patients had concurrent HAPA identified.
Conclusions:
- DH and HAPA are infrequent complications of liver trauma.
- DH following liver trauma was not associated with HAPA on imaging.
- HAPAs appear to cause insidious bleeding and hemoglobin decline, not catastrophic rupture.
